How do I write a story?

You must first sign in. Once authenticated, click "Start Writing" in the navigation bar to compose your first chapter and set your cover art.

What is a magic link?

We removed passwords entirely. When you log in, we send a secure, single-use link to your email inbox. Click it, and you're immediately authenticated into the universe.

Can I hide my story after publishing?

Yes. Head to your Dashboard and click the pause icon next to your manuscript. This immediately hides it from the public directory while keeping your content safe.

Do I own my work?

Absolutely. SOULPAD claims no copyright over your original fiction. You grant us permission strictly to host and display it. For more details, read our Terms of Service.

How does Monetization work?

Once you reach certain milestones (like 5,000 global reads and 50 hours of reading time), you become eligible for our Creator Program. You can apply through the Monetization Hub to start earning revenue based on reader engagement and tips.

How does SOULPAD protect against piracy?

We take IP protection seriously. Our reader utilizes advanced Piracy Guard technology, which includes dynamic invisible watermarking, screenshot tracking, and right-click disabling. If a manuscript is leaked, we can trace exactly which account captured it.

What are Licenses in the Codex Registry?

Licenses are official, verifiable certificates issued by the High Council to register your intellectual property on SOULPAD. This provides a timestamped, unalterable proof of creation for your chronicles, which you can even print out.

Are there content restrictions?

We champion creative freedom, but strictly prohibit hate speech, non-consensual explicit content, and plagiarism. AI-generated spam is also forbidden. Please review our Content Guidelines before publishing.

How do I report a stolen story?

If you find content that violates copyright or community guidelines, click the "Report" flag icon found on every story page. Our Moderation Council investigates every report within 48 hours.
